Asma Boulaid (Morocco) Master of Finance ASRF 2017-2018, CFA Track

After my studies at IGR-IAE Rennes, I was able to get a great internship at Egencia/Expedia Group as a Finance Business analyst. I now work at BNP Paribas CIB as a consultant in Project management.

This master will allow you to master main finance courses, understand how financial markets work and provide you with deep knowledge in corporate finance and international Accounting.

You can have access to Bloomberg platform, you also can pass the AMF certificate which is valuable in the Banking sector especially. Other than that, the program is really interesting, the professors are very approachable. You can ask them for advice and they are glad to help.


Francis Osei-Tutu (Ghana) Master of Finance ASRF 2017-2018, Research Track

What impressed me the most was the emphasis on quality education and research, the attention of the faculty and administrative staff, and the nice reception I received at the airport from the IGR Buddy program. The city of Rennes was also very welcoming: I enjoyed student life in Rennes where almost everything is built around University life.

Now, I am undertaking my PhD research in Finance at the University of Strasbourg. The in-depth theoretical understanding and the strong research and investigative skills I acquired during my Master degree have been essential for my PhD journey. Alongside my studies, I also work as a teaching fellow at the EM Strasbourg Business School where I teach courses in Financial Performance Analysis and Basics in Financial Analysis.
